I just get a technical details:

Model Name: Fender ‘50th Anniversary American Standard Stratocaster® (Limited Edition)

Model Number: 010-7400-(Color#)

Series: Limited Edition Series

Body: Alder with Highly Figured Flame Maple Top and Back

Neck: Maple

Fingerboard: Rosewood (9.5” Radius/241 mm)

No. of Frets: 22

Scale Length: 25.5” (648 mm)

Width @ Nut: 1.6875” (43mm)

Hardware: Gold (Special Commemorative Limited Edition Serial Numbered Neckplate)

Machine Heads: Gold American Standard

Bridge: Gold American Standard Tremolo

Pickguard: 3-Ply White

Pickups: American Standard 50th Pickups

Pickup Switching: 5 Position Switch

Controls: Master Volume, Tone (Neck), Tone (Mid-Bridge)

Colors: (837) Antique Burst

Strings: Fender Super 250L’s (.009 to .042) Nickel Plated Steel pn#073-0250-003

Unique Features: Flame Maple Top and Back,

Gold Hardware,

Commemorative Neck Plate

Source: U.S.

Accessories: Case, Whammy bar


NOTICE: Prices and Specifications Subject to Change Without Notice

INTRODUCED: 1/1996

DISCONTINUED: 1/1997

DISCONTINUED COLORS:

COMMENTS: Only 2500 Pieces Made

WRENCH SIZES: Truss Rod Wrench #023811 (1/8” Hex)

Saddle Height Adjustment Wrench #018531 (.050 Hex)

The one in the auction looks legit to me - while all 1996 Fenders got that medallion on the back of the headstock there was a "50th Anniversary of Fender" Strats(and companion Tele, P-Bass, and J-Bass); they were American Standards with gold hardware, that darker burst finish and maple veneers on the top and bottom of the body (like a Strat Ultra). They were production models, not CS. However, I would feel better about the auction if there was a photo of the neck plate as well.

For the History:
- All Strat`s 1996 are 50th Anniversary ( 50 Years of Fender Company)

-2500 Pieces of Strat with Golden Hardware (S xxxx of S2500) Limited Edition
with Golden Neck Plate

-50th Anniversary Strat`s 2004 (50 Years of Fender Stratocaster-model)
